Popular WebAug 21, 2024 · First, we’ll need to create a new user. Git uses SSH for authentication and all traffic between servers and clients, so we’ll need a service user to manage the repo. sudo useradd git Next, switch to the git user for the rest of the setup: su git You’ll need to add your SSH keys to the git user’s authorized_keys file: nano ~/.ssh/authorized_keys

WebOct 11, 2024 · Since our library is ready to use, let’s test it. Let’s use a fresh virtual environment and install our library, from the terminal/git bash: pip install virtualenv virtualenv venv source venv/Scripts/activate. Then, let’s install our library using git+ssh. The syntax is as-follows: pip install git+ssh://[email protected]#egg=name

WebInitializing a new repository: git init. To create a new repo, you'll use the git init command. git init is a one-time command you use during the initial setup of a new repo. Executing this command will create a new .git subdirectory in your current working directory.
